Water Operator II

EPCOR

Description

Highlights of the role

EPCOR is on the lookout for a Water Operator at our Sandow Water Treatment Plant near Lexington, TX. This role offers an exciting opportunity for skilled professionals to contribute to the vital task of water treatment in a dynamic and 24/7/365, in a rotating shift environment, staffed facility.


What you'll be responsible for

  • Operate high level water treatment equipment such as Reverse Osmosis, Ultrafiltration Skids and Cold Lime Softening systems, groundwater wells, remote stations and reservoirs
  • Perform extensive laboratory analysis
  • Maintain, calibrate, and verify continuous on-line water quality analyzers
  • Perform operations, maintenance, and control work on water treatment plant, chlorination equipment, pump control valves, various pressure control valves
  • Install and make repairs on piping, valves, and other components of water treatment plant
  • Perform facility, well, and remote site rounds
  • Analyze data and communicate results effectively
  • Participate in process control strategies and implementation
  • Perform construction and fabrication at facility
  • Maintain landscaping as needed
  • Operate equipment such as cranes, forklifts, trenchers, backhoes, bucket-lifts and dump trucks as required
What's required to be successful
  • High school diploma or equivalent required
  • 2+ years of related experience with field maintenance, water or wastewater plant maintenance, or other mechanical maintenance experience
  • Experience with mechanical maintenance and repair of pumps, compressors, engines and related equipment at a water or wastewater facility
  • TCEQ Class A, B, C or D water license required
  • Knowledge of water systems and associated maintenance necessities
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office suite including Word, Excel, and Outlook
  • Willingness and ability to increase knowledge in maintenance area operations including equipment operation and use
  • Valid driver's license and ability to maintain a clean driving record
